About Cataract Surgery

Cataract removal is a safe and effective procedure and is the most frequently performed surgery in the U.S. Cataract surgery has undergone tremendous technological advances in recent years. There was a time when cataract surgery could only restore a patient’s distance vision. But today, thanks to the breakthrough AcrySof® ReSTOR® IQ intraocular lens (IOL), Dr. Bryan can help you enjoy crisp, clear, glasses-free vision from near to far. He will evaluate and work with you to decide which IOL is best for your visual needs.

There are three options that you may choose from:

  • Conventional Cataract Surgery uses a monofocal lens that corrects only one range of vision (usually distance). When choosing this option, you will require reading glasses for fine print or to see small objects.
  • ReSTOR® Cataract Surgery uses a multifocal lens that is designed to correct a range of vision – near through distance. In the past, life without reading glasses or bifocals was simply not an option for cataract patients after surgery. Click on About ReSTOR® IQ for more details.
  • Toric Cataract Surgery uses the AcrySof® Toric IQ lens. It’s the first IOL that treats preexisting astigmatism at the same time it corrects cataracts.

Cataract Surgery

The Procedure - Life-changing results in minutes

Dr Bryan will perform this virtually painless surgery on one eye at a time. No injections are needed, only anesthetic eye drops. He will make a tiny incision in your eye, remove its natural clouded lens, and replace it with a new lens. The actual surgery takes approximately thirty minutes and the results are permanent and life changing. You will return home to rest after surgery. Steroid, antibiotic and anti-inflammatory eye drops are given to you for comfort, safety and rapid healing. In fact, most patients are back to their normal activities in just a few days.
